估计不需要那么久。五到十年够了。
编程需要天赋,更需要兴趣的持续驱动。如果一个人只是为了纯粹的高薪而选择编程的话,那他必然不会主动的去花费时间和精力去学习提升自己。这样久而久之,随着年纪的增加,这些人必然会被时代所淘汰。
不论做任何工作,只有自己发自内心的真正的喜欢这件事情,自己愿意主动的去学习,去提升自我,这样自己才会永远保持一定的竞争力,否则被淘汰也就是迟早的事情了。
如果程序员都能被替代掉,那多少行业也该被替代掉?
哦,好像老师也不需要了,哦哦,学生也没用了,哦哦哦,这世界要人有什么用?
机器人自动生产代码,问题是真有这能力真的会运用吗?
ai智能是核心
如果计算机代替人工作,程序员也是最后失业的一批人,因为人工智能再怎么也需要发展。AI都能自我优化的时候其他行业也早就被取代了
准确说,计算机会取代码农,而不是正儿八经的程序员,你以为程序员写的仅仅是代码吗?写得都是逻辑和设计
那这个可以让机器自动编程的程序是谁编写出来了???
他说的其实是应用层面的程序员,也就是现在国内的几乎所有的码农!我认为说的挺有道理!
是人创造了机器运行逻辑,而非机器创造人的运行逻辑!程序员是逻辑的创造者,程序员会消失吗?只会出现更标准化的逻辑模块,出现更高级简单的语言,这个有可能。
这个老师是以偏概全!有一部分代码的确是不用写了,就像目前的集成开发环境能生成代码那样。但是核心的需求逻辑、业务流程、代码优化一定需要人去做。
这位老师忽视了程序设计的复杂性。
我感觉这是不现实的,至少在未来的100年才会出现这样的情况,
但凡入了门的开发者都不可能说出这种话。最初还没ide,甚至没有操作系统的时候,需要编机器码运行,然后有了汇编,有了高级语言、脚本语言。语言越来越人性化,ide也越来越智能化,很多繁琐的功能都可以封装。但是,程序之所以为程序,在于他的逻辑,或者说编程语言都是在为逻辑服务。程序员干的事情,就是把一种原始的、模糊的、甚至矛盾百出的业务通过自己大脑梳理出清晰可行的逻辑,这东西是弱人工智能永远无法取代的。只有当人工智拥有自己的思维,达到甚至超越人脑的时候,才有可能,真到那个时候,世界上还有什么职业是人工智能不能取代的?
如果这样说的话,老师更容易被取代,特别是大学老师,理论课可以用视频代替,实验很多大学老师他们自己也不比学生强
个人认为程序员并不会被完全取代,由机器生成的统一编码只能从功能上完成任务,但如果要追求性能,统一编码不能很好针对个体问题针对性编码,肯定还是需要程序员,但肯定的是水平一般的程序员肯定会大量减少
未来是多久以后呢?
不会全部,但是门槛会降低
理想浪漫主义,编码并不是机械重复工作,是复杂问题的处理能力,甚至要求沟通变通能力,要求很高!我估计机器ai什么时候能取代人类,像个真人一样处理日常各种人际事务,懂得变通,迂回,进退,取舍,联想?20年肯定不行。